Peritoneal Dialysis (PD) is another form of home dialysis which uses your own peritoneum – a natural membrane that covers the abdominal organs and lines the abdominal wall to filter wastes. The peritoneum is a porous or sponge-like membrane that allows toxins and fluid to be filtered from the blood.

WebApr 2, 2024 · Peritoneal dialysis is done to remove wastes, chemicals, and extra fluid from your body. A liquid called dialysate is put into your abdomen through a catheter (thin tube). The liquid stays in your abdomen for several hours at a time. This is called dwell time. WebJan 17, 2024 · Gantar instilled saline solution in the peritoneal cavity of uremic guinea pigs and subsequently treated a uremic woman with peritoneal dialysis solution containing saline. Heusser added dextrose to the peritoneal dialysis solution to improve ultrafiltration. In 1938, Rhoads added lactate to the peritoneal dialysis fluid to correct acidosis.
